"What time is this racket supposed to be, anyway ?" "Eight sharp," said Grove Bronson.
"Are we going to go all separated together or all separated at once ?" Roy asked.
"Positively," said Warde Hollister.
"Positively what ?" asked Connie Bennett.
"It's all the same to me, only different," said Roy.

"Only this is what I was thinking.

We all have supper at different times except Pee-wee and he has supper all the time.

As Abraham Lincoln said at the battle of Marne, 'Some people are half hungry all the time, some people are all hungry half the time, but Pee-wee is _all_ hungry _all_ the time.' I wonder where he is anyway ?" "Down in Bennett's having a soda, I guess," said Westy Martin.
"Is he going to the party ?" Tom Warner asked.
"Search me," said Westy.

"I guess not, he doesn't dance.
